Cause

Event ID 1075 is a Windows error message generated when a Windows service cannot be started due to a dependency issue. Some Enterprise Vault services depend on other services, such as Microsoft Message Queuing Service.

Resolution

Verify if the Message Queuing component is installed and the service is in Running status. If the Message Queuing component is not installed, refer to the Windows documentation to install the Message Queuing component.
 

Note: There are two Enterprise Vault services that depend of the Microsoft Message Queuing service:

  • Enterprise Vault Storage Service.
  • Enterprise Vault Task Controller Service.
